Sustainable Materials

Sustainable materials are transforming modern kitchen design. Many homeowners now prioritize eco-friendly choices. These materials reduce environmental impact. They also enhance the kitchen’s aesthetic appeal. Let’s explore some popular sustainable options.

Eco-friendly Countertops

Eco-friendly countertops are gaining popularity. They are made from recycled or natural materials. Options include recycled glass and bamboo. Recycled glass countertops are vibrant and unique. Bamboo is durable and renewable. Both choices are stylish and sustainable. They offer beauty with a smaller carbon footprint.

Reclaimed Wood Cabinets

Reclaimed wood cabinets add rustic charm. They reuse wood from old buildings or furniture. This reduces the need for new lumber. Each piece tells a story. They offer a unique, aged look. Reclaimed wood is durable and environmentally friendly. These cabinets make a kitchen feel warm and inviting.

Hidden Storage Solutions

Clutter can quickly overwhelm a kitchen. Hidden storage solutions are a game-changer, offering a sleek look while maximizing space. You might have seen those nifty pull-out pantry shelves that make use of narrow gaps. Or consider toe-kick drawers—perfect for storing baking sheets and cutting boards. These clever ideas ensure every inch of space is used effectively. Which hidden storage solution would make your kitchen more functional?

Streamlined Designs

Streamlined designs focus on simplicity and clean lines. Cabinet doors often have flat surfaces and minimal hardware. These designs reduce visual clutter, making kitchens look spacious. Sleek countertops complement streamlined cabinets. The use of neutral colors enhances the minimalist feel. Streamlined designs are practical and easy to maintain.

Open Shelving Concepts

Open shelving adds a modern touch to kitchens. It creates an airy and open atmosphere. Shelves display kitchen items, adding personality to the space. Open shelves offer easy access to frequently used items. They encourage organization and reduce clutter. This concept blends functionality with aesthetic appeal. Indoor Herb Gardens

Indoor herb gardens are gaining popularity in modern kitchens. They provide fresh ingredients at your fingertips. Growing herbs indoors enhances the kitchen’s visual appeal. It adds a touch of greenery and life. Small pots or vertical planters can fit any kitchen size. They also improve air quality and offer a fresh aroma. Herbs like basil, mint, and thyme are easy to maintain. These gardens can be both functional and decorative.

Stone Accents

Stone accents add a rustic touch to kitchen design. They bring a sense of durability and elegance. Natural stones like granite and marble are popular choices. They offer unique textures and patterns. Stone countertops and backsplashes create a timeless look. These materials are also heat and scratch-resistant. Stone accents blend well with wood and metal features. They enhance the overall aesthetic of the kitchen.

Retro Appliances

Retro appliances add a fun vibe to your kitchen. They offer style and function. Think pastel-colored refrigerators and rounded stoves. Retro toasters and mixers are also popular. These appliances often have a smooth, curved design. They echo the 1950s and 1960s style. Retro appliances marry vintage aesthetics with modern technology. They enhance kitchen charm while serving practical needs.

Classic Tile Patterns

Classic tile patterns bring timeless beauty to kitchen floors. Herringbone and checkerboard designs are making a comeback. Subway tiles add a clean, simple look. They are versatile and fit many styles. Classic tiles offer durability and easy maintenance. They enhance the kitchen’s visual appeal. These tiles create a warm and inviting atmosphere. They make your kitchen a cozy gathering place.

Custom Backsplashes

Custom backsplashes are a great way to personalize your kitchen. They allow for creativity and expression. Tile patterns can vary from simple to intricate designs. Materials range from glass to ceramic and metal. Choose colors that complement your kitchen’s theme. Add mosaic pieces for a splash of color. Murals can tell a story or reflect hobbies. Custom backsplashes offer endless possibilities.

Unique Hardware Choices

Hardware choices can elevate kitchen design. Knobs and handles come in various styles. Options include vintage, modern, or rustic designs. Materials like brass, copper, or wood add distinct touches. Custom designs offer unmatched uniqueness. Mix and match for a playful look. Consider shapes and textures. Unique hardware can transform cabinets and drawers. It’s a simple way to personalize your kitchen.
